Israel has accused Iran of consistently firing cluster munitions during their 10-day conflict, posing a severe challenge to Israel's air defense systems. These weapons disperse bomblets over wide areas, making them difficult to intercept and causing indiscriminate harm to civilians. Israeli authorities are educating the public about the dangers of unexploded ordnance. While over 120 countries have banned cluster munitions, Israel, the United States, and Iran are not signatories to the treaty. Experts like Yehoshua Kalisky and N. R. Jenzen-Jones highlight the indiscriminate nature and 'weapon of terror' design of Iran's cluster munitions. Amnesty International has condemned Iran's actions as a violation of international humanitarian law. The event draws parallels to past conflicts where cluster munitions were used by various nations, including Israel in 2006.
